Как ускорить удаленные запросы MySql [закрыто]

У меня есть сервер MySQL, работающий на веб-сервере (example.com), и команда продавцов создает продажи с помощью устройств Android, и продажи регистрируются на этом сервере с помощью REST API.

Производственный цех, финансовый отдел и отдел кадров расположены в трех разных местах, и система на базе Windows работает в этих местах и ​​подключается к тому же серверу MySQL, который работает в Интернете.

Все нормально и работает. Однако при попытке создать некоторые отчеты, требующие ряда запросов и значительно больших наборов данных, системе требуется время для загрузки с сервера MySQL. Это не проблема при подключении к локальным серверам баз данных.

Я знаю, что в MySQL есть опция, называемая репликацией, которую я еще не реализовал, потому что мои локальные базы данных не имеют доступа из Интернета, и, если она будет реализована, все базы данных, работающие в производстве, финансах, HR и Интернете, нуждаются в двунаправленной репликации. Мои знания об этой «репликации» минимальны, и я ищу обходной путь для ускорения работы системы.

Прошу ваших достойных мнений, помощи.

Заранее спасибо.

0 ответов

Другие вопросы по тегам